"This is a big day, Derek," Casey said quietly with suppressed excitement, her arms around him. The morning sun shone through Casey's bedroom window. The two of them stood in their pajamas on a Monday morning, a few days after they had decided they were "officially" together.

Derek tried to squirm away and roll his eyes. "It's no big deal, Case… it's just school," he told her, holding his hands up, exasperated at the deal she was making of it.

"Just school? Just school? Derek!" Casey smacked him lightly. "It's your first day back after how long? It IS a big deal!"

"Casey! It-"

"I'm so proud of you," she murmured, pressing her lips to his in a chaste kiss. Derek's expression changed instantly.

"Well…" he started, wrapped his arms around her. "Maybe it's sorta a big deal…" He wiggled his eyebrows at her. She just smacked him playfully and pushed him out of her bedroom saying that she still had to get dressed. "Okay, okay," he surrendered. "But I get the bathroom first!" With that, he sprinted out and off to the bathroom.

"No! De-RECK!" she cried out in frustration, only to be answered with his muffled laughter from behind the closed door. Still, she couldn't help but smile a little as she picked her clothes out for the day.

Downstairs, Nora and George heard Casey screech at her stepbrother and looked at each other.

"Should we…?" George started.

"No," Nora said, shaking her head. If there was a problem between them, she was sure Casey would come racing down the stairs to complain about it… why go to her? Then something dawned on her.

"Georgie… How long has it been since you've heard that?" Nora asked him.

George continued to read his paper and sip his coffee, then answer distractedly, "I don't know, a few weeks…" a lightbulb went on "since before Derek got sick. Do you think he's finally…?"

But before he even finished his sentence, Derek came bounding down the stairs. A wet towel flew at his head and Casey's voice followed, "Augh! You're so- GROSS!"

Nora and George watched, happy to see their living dead son more of the living and less of the dead. Derek plopped down at the table. "So, what's for breakfast!" he said obnoxiously. "Ed! Get me some breakfast!" he called over his shoulder. When Edwin didn't appear, he looked around and then at George.

Nora swallowed her excitement at seeing him healthy again and answered, "Edwin and Lizzie had to go in early today… It's good to see you up and running again, Derek."

"Mm," he grunted, disinterestedly, searching the cabinets. Finding the cereal, he filled his bowl and poured milk on the giant mound. He was just finishing stuffing his face when Casey pranced down the stairs and into the kitchen.

"Good morning, Mom! George!" she greeted cheerily. Nora looked over at George in surprise again, this time at seeing her daughter in such a good mood. She had been getting worried since the other night because, even though Casey hadn't had any more episodes, she hadn't been completely Casey either.

Just when Casey went to grab the cereal, Derek stopped her with an 'uh-uh!' She gave him a look. "Bus is leaving, princess," he teased, walking to the door and dangling the keys over his shoulder. Casey made a strangling action with her hands, let out a frustrated cry, and stormed out after him.

Nora and George chuckled to themselves, each sipping their coffees, delighted that things finally looked normal again.
